@philr clear is the rebranded version of xohm. Also don't expect wimax in Grand Rapids anytime soon, I know that since the begging Sprint and Clearwire have focused on Grand Rapids but with the lawsuits going on Sprint is ok selling 'Clear' as long as it isn't in iPCS areas, of which Grand Rapis is. iPCS has said they wouldn't block the merger as long as no 'Clear' in iPCS markets. Don't be suprised to see Grand Rapids put off instead of forcing another issue in the courts. I know the merger has now gone through, but iPCS has had a good track record in the courts against Sprint lately.
